Gananoque

Canada

Gananoque, Canada is a picturesque town located in the Thousand Islands region of Ontario. It is known for its stunning waterfront views, vibrant culture, and natural beauty. The historic downtown area is full of interesting shops, restaurants, and galleries. For those who enjoy outdoor activities, there are plenty of trails to explore in the surrounding area. The 1000 Islands Casino Resort is also located here, offering a variety of gaming options, as well as entertainment and dining. With its unique location and charming atmosphere, Gananoque is the perfect destination for a getaway or short vacation.

What to See in Gananoque

1. Thousand Islands National Park: A stunning natural area with over 20 islands, stretching across the St. Lawrence River and boasting stunning views and diverse wildlife.

2. Boldt Castle: A turn-of-the-century castle, constructed on Heart Island on the St. Lawrence River. Visitors can explore the castle and grounds, and take a boat tour of the Thousand Islands.

3. Gananoque Boat Line: A boat tour service offering sightseeing and dinner cruises along the St. Lawrence River.

4. Gananoque River: A beautiful river that winds its way through the town, providing a peaceful escape from the hustle and bustle of city life.

5. Thousand Islands Playhouse: A professional theatre offering a variety of plays, musicals and cabarets throughout the summer months.
